| Bioactivity | Quazomotide is a WT1 class II peptide epitope with sequences of RSDELVRHHNMHQRNMTKL. Quazomotide stimulates a peptide-specific CD4(+) response, to recognize WT1(+) tumor cells. Quazomotide is an immunological agent for active immunization, as well as an antineoplastic agent[1][2]. |
| Name | Quazomotide |
| CAS | 935395-33-8 |
| Sequence | Arg-Ser-Asp-Glu-Leu-Val-Arg-His-His-Asn-Met-His-Gln-Arg-Asn-Met-Thr-Lys-Leu |
| Shortening | RSDELVRHHNMHQRNMTKL |
| Formula | C98H164N38O29S2 |
| Molar Mass | 2402.72 |
